Help With My '89 300CE

In January I bought an '89 300CE - which I love! About April I started having problems with it dieing at a stop - it would just loose power and be difficult to restart. I took it to the "local" MB dealer (70 miles away) and they replaced the fuel pump relay. I then drove it from Arkansas to California with no problems. However, when I got home the problems started all over again - at a stop shuddering loosing power all warning lights coming on and dieing - and it was getting harder and harder to restart, but once it was restarted it would run perfect for a week or so. 'Bout the third time this happened after my return from California I had it towed to the dealer. They claimed it started right up for them and they couldn't duplicate the problem I was having - so they replaced the crankshaft sensor. Drove fine for about a week -then I didn't drive it for a week because of the weather - tried to start it last Sunday - nothing it won't start at all now - it turns over - makes a "popping and hissing noise", least that's what it sounds like to me, but won't start.

I have to admit I am "mechanically challenged" - so what I would like from ya'll is a list to take to my MB dealer and say "I want you to check x,y and z. Please... The dealer claims the codes come back fine, and starts and runs everytime for them.
